Display settings for large models with 0D meshes
When you load, import, or append a model that contains 0D meshes, the default display settings for those meshes are as follows:
The Element Marker option is set to Hide.
The Display Text check box is cleared.
With settings, the software does not display the marker and associated text (the abbreviated element name) for the 0D elements in the model by default. However, the software still displays the 0D elements. These display settings can improve the performance when you load or import a FEM file that contains a large number of 0D meshes.
Note:
You can use options in the Mesh Display dialog box to turn on the display of element markers and text.

You can use the Part Load Element Display customer defaults to control the display of 0D mesh collectors in the Simulation Navigator when you import large models.
Select the Limit Display for Large Models check box to have the software turn off the display of 0D mesh collectors in the Simulation Navigator of the number of 0D elements exceeds a specified threshold.
Then, use the Maximum Number of Elements to Display option to specify the largest number of 0D elements to display when the software loads the part.

Where do I find it?
| Menu | File→Utilities→Customer Defaults |
|---|---|
| Location in dialog box | Pre/Post→Mesh Display→0D Mesh page |
